Aerie 1287, Fraternal Order of Eagles v. Holland

Citations

  • 226 N.W.2d 22
  • 1975 Iowa Sup. LEXIS 931

How courts have described this case

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.

  • concluding that board’s allowance of a partial exemption obviated need on appeal to determine whether the taxpayer qualified as a charitable organization
  • holding that only issue before the appellate court was whether the partial exemption granted by the district court should be higher; in the absence of a cross-appeal, presumably by the assessor, court would not consider whether exemption should be less than that allowed
  • “Courts must strive to give effect to all the language of a contract.”
  • “[A]n agreement is to be interpreted as a whole.”
